Step 2 – Set Up Auto Cash‑out
Auto cash‑out is the safety net that locks in winnings automatically at a preset multiplier. Here’s how to enable it:
- Locate the “Auto Cash‑out” slider beneath the betting panel.
- Drag the slider to your desired multiplier (e.g., 2.5×, 5×, 10×).
- Activate the toggle to turn the feature on.
When the live multiplier reaches your chosen level, the system will cash you out instantly, even if you are away from the keyboard.
Pro tip: For a medium‑high volatility game like Red Baron, many players set auto cash‑out at 5×. This balances risk and reward while protecting you from sudden crashes.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Chasing losses. After a crash, many players increase their stake hoping to recover. This often leads to bigger losses, especially in a medium‑high volatility game.
- Setting auto cash‑out too high. A 15× target may sound exciting, but the crash probability at that point is very high.
- Ignoring the RTP. Red Baron’s high‑RTP of 97 % means the house edge is low, but only over thousands of rounds. Short sessions can still be unlucky.
- Playing without a budget. Fast rounds can drain funds quickly. Set a loss limit before you start.

Q: How does the 97 % RTP affect my chances?
A: RTP is the long‑term return to players. A 97 % RTP means, on average, you get back €97 for every €100 wagered over many rounds.
